The Rise of "Work With Me" Streams
The popularity of streams like the "fancyxlove" 12 Oct session highlights a growing trend in digital consumption: body doubling. This productivity strategy involves working in the presence of another person—even virtually—to increase focus and accountability.
Atmospheric Vibes: Many creators use lo-fi music, aesthetically pleasing desk setups, and soft lighting to create a "fancy" or cozy environment.
Deep Focus: These sessions are often characterized by long periods of silence or minimal interaction, mimicking a library or a shared office space.
